How to Optimize Multi-Location SEO for Insulation Companies
1. Set Up Individual Google Business Profiles (GBPs) for Each Location
Each location of your spray foam business should have a separate and optimized Google Business Profile with:
-
Accurate business name, address, and phone number (NAP consistency)
-
Localized business descriptions using primary and secondary keywords
-
High-quality images showcasing past projects, trucks, and team members
-
Customer reviews specific to each location
-
Service areas clearly defined
-
Regular updates with Google Posts
2. Create Dedicated Location Pages on Your Website
Instead of listing all your locations on one page, build separate landing pages for each city or service area. These pages should include:
-
Unique, localized content (Avoid duplicate content across pages)
-
City-specific keywords (e.g., "spray foam insulation in [city]")
-
Google Maps embed to show your business location
-
Customer testimonials from that location
-
Service details relevant to the area
3. Optimize Website Structure for Local SEO
For multi-location insulation businesses, a well-organized website improves search rankings. Key elements include:
-
Clear navigation (Dropdown menu with service areas)
-
Internal linking strategy (Link between location pages and blog content)
-
Mobile-friendly design (Most customers search for insulation services on mobile)
-
Fast-loading pages (Google prioritizes websites with better user experience)
4. Use Localized Keywords in Content and Metadata
Incorporate location-based keywords throughout your website:
-
Page Titles: "Spray Foam Insulation Services in [City]"
-
Meta Descriptions: "Looking for reliable insulation in [City]? We provide top-rated spray foam solutions for homes and businesses."
-
Headings (H1, H2, H3): Naturally include local SEO keywords
-
Content: Write informative blogs targeting common local questions
5. Implement Local Link Building Strategies
Building local authority is crucial for multi-location SEO. Effective link-building tactics include:
-
Partnering with local businesses (contractors, realtors, and home improvement companies)
-
Getting listed in industry directories (HomeAdvisor, Angi, and SprayFoam.com)
-
Sponsoring local events or joining chambers of commerce for high-quality backlinks
6. Manage and Respond to Location-Specific Reviews
Google prioritizes businesses with positive and consistent reviews. Encourage satisfied customers to leave reviews mentioning the city and specific service they received. Respond professionally to all reviews to build trust.
7. Use Schema Markup for Local SEO
Adding LocalBusiness schema markup helps search engines understand your business details better, increasing your chances of appearing in rich search results.

FAQs About Multi-Location SEO for Insulation Companies
1. How long does it take to see results from multi-location SEO?
SEO results vary, but with consistent optimization, businesses typically see improvements within 3-6 months. Faster results depend on factors like competition, website authority, and local search trends.
2. Do I need a separate website for each business location?
No, but you should have dedicated location pages for each service area. This improves search visibility while keeping your website manageable.
3. How can I track my multi-location SEO performance?
Use tools like Google Search Console, Google Analytics, and GBP Insights to monitor traffic, rankings, and conversions for each location.
4. What are the biggest challenges of multi-location SEO?
Common challenges include NAP inconsistencies, duplicate content issues, and managing multiple Google Business Profiles. Working with an SEO expert can help overcome these hurdles.
5. Can I use the same content on all my location pages?
No, duplicate content hurts SEO. Each page should have unique, location-specific content to rank well in local searches.
